How Toner Type Affects Pressure Roller Wear

The formulation of toner used in a laser printer has a major impact how rapidly the pressure roller breaks down. Toner is far more than basic powder that contains various additives, including thermoplastic binders, release agents, and iron oxides, all crafted to permanently bond when exposed to heat and pressure.


Different toner formulations have distinct thermal thresholds, crystalline structures, and surface energies, all of which shape the wear dynamics during repeated use.


Toner with coarse or gritty granules tends to create more friction against the roller's surface. This elevated abrasion generates more heat and physical wear, especially if the toner incorporates hardening agents such as zirconia. Over time, this often damages the silicone coating of the pressure roller to etch into a glossy, uneven texture, leading to inconsistent toner transfer and visual anomalies such as banding or ghosting.


On the other hand, toners with finer, more uniform particles and softer additives minimize wear pressure. These formulations often are sourced from OEM suppliers and are crafted for energy-efficient bonding, reducing the overall mechanical load on the roller. Some toners also feature silicone-based lubricants that block electrostatic cling, which slows surface degradation.


Using third party or remanufactured toner can frequently cause abnormal friction profiles. While these options provide budget-friendly alternatives, they are sometimes bypass quality benchmarks. Inconsistent particle size or خرابی غلطک پرس پرینتر poor quality control can produce sticky deposits, and early mechanical breakdown.


Regular maintenance, such as cleaning the roller and replacing toner before it runs too low can reduce the risk of premature failure, but the toner quality constitutes the core influence. Choosing the compatible toner for your printer not only ensures better print quality but also reduces wear on heat-sensitive mechanisms. In the long run, investing in compatible, high quality toner can minimize service calls and operational interruptions.
